Understanding Student Loans

Before diving into the specifics of obtaining a student loan without a cosigner, it’s essential to understand the different types of student loans available. There are federal student loans, which typically offer more favorable terms and lower interest rates, and private student loans, which can vary widely in terms of interest rates and repayment options.

Federal Student Loans

For many students, federal student loans are the best option. These loans do not require a cosigner, and they often come with benefits like income-driven repayment plans and loan forgiveness programs. To qualify for federal student loans, you must complete the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A). This application assesses your financial need and determines your eligibility for various federal aid programs.

Private Student Loans

If federal loans do not cover your educational expenses, you may need to consider private student loans. However, many private lenders require a cosigner, particularly for borrowers with limited credit history. To improve your chances of getting approved for a private loan without a cosigner, consider the following strategies:

1. Build Your Credit History

One of the most critical factors lenders consider is your credit history. If you are a young borrower, you may not have a significant credit history. Start building your credit by opening a credit card, making small purchases, and paying your bills on time. This will help demonstrate your creditworthiness to potential lenders.

2. Show Proof of Income

Lenders want to see that you can repay the loan. If you have a part-time job or other sources of income, gather documentation to prove your earnings. This can include pay stubs, tax returns, or bank statements. A stable income can strengthen your loan application.

3. Consider a Creditworthy Co-Borrower

While you may not want a cosigner, consider finding a co-borrower who is willing to share the responsibility of the loan. A co-borrower with a strong credit history can improve your chances of approval and may even secure you a lower interest rate.

4. Research Lenders

Not all lenders have the same requirements. Some specialize in loans for students without cosigners. Research various lenders, compare their terms, and look for those that offer loans specifically designed for independent students.

5. Apply for Scholarships and Grants

Reducing your overall need for loans is another effective strategy. Look for scholarships and grants that can help cover your tuition and expenses. Many organizations offer financial aid based on merit, need, or specific demographics.
